### Runbook: AlertFold Deduplicator — Release Step 4

Before promoting the AlertFold deduplicator build, verify that the suppression-window config matches the values approved in the change review, and that the replay test against last week's alert corpus shows zero dropped pages. Confirm the dedup hash function version is pinned; a mismatch will silently split alert groups. Once verification passes, sign the release bundle so the deploy gate accepts it. The signing key for this release line appears below.

signing key of bagap-yawep = bky13_TbfT6ZMUoGJo2

Account Recovery — Pagewright Static Builds

If a customer loses access to their Pagewright dashboard, incremental rebuilds of their static site will continue from the last known-good deploy, so no content is lost during recovery. Confirm the customer's last rebuild timestamp in the Orlin console, then initiate the recovery flow from the admin panel. Do not trigger a full rebuild until access is restored. Unlocking the recovery flow requires the passphrase below.

recovery phrase for yadup-taguf: wenael-quenox-kelix

Subject: Schema registry cut-over complete

Team — cut-over of event schemas from the legacy Brinmark store to the new Ostrel Registry finished last night. All producers now validate against Ostrel before publish. Legacy reads stay enabled for two weeks, then hard cutoff. Expect a few tickets about rejected events with stale schema versions; point users to the upgrade note. No rollback planned. For troubleshooting, the registry's active configuration values are listed below.

deployment values, yadug-bawif:
[framir]
team = pelox
access_code = ac_a38ab2
owner = tamion.julael
host = framir.tolvaqlabs.test
port = 11211
peer = tammir.zemvargrid.local
salt = 2215ef03
pin = 1541

Heads up on the permessage-deflate settings in the Glimmerhop gateway: compression saves bandwidth but opens us to CRIME-style oracles if we compress attacker-influenced frames next to session tokens. I've disabled context takeover for client frames and capped window bits. Here are the constants I settled on for review.

tuning constants:
QUOTAS = {
    "druwyn": 5,
    "holix": 5,
    "zorath": 5,
    "holwyn": 10,
}